Opening in 1955 with 38 students, GIS now provides a world class education to 1419 students, aged 3 to 18 and representing over 50 nations. The primary curriculum is grounded in the National Curriculum of England. Secondary studies lead to IGCSE and A-level examinations, with impressive results. GIS alumni occupy prominent positions in business and public affairs worldwide. The School is operated as a non-profit company. Policy is set by Board of Directors, constituted to reflect the international and multicultural character of the School.
